NeXT Megapixel Display N4000 Repair

 
Last weekend's repair project: A NeXT Megapixel Display with a wavy picture.
I suspected a failing filter capacitor. I replaced that and the remaining 36-year-old electrolytic capacitors as a preventative measure. It was a time consuming process, but the surgery was a success.

My N4000's logic board (1-623-855-12) varied from the revision on AsteronTech's NeXT MegaPixel Refurb page. Here's the capacitor list for my specific version:
